Backfill scheduler basics (Project Nightloom): nightly jobs queue at 01:00, oldest partition first. Never rerun a backfill without clearing its ledger row, or you get duplicates. Dashboards show lag per dataset. Escalate if lag exceeds two days. To unlock the scheduler's admin vault on first login, use the passphrase below.

unlock words, hahap-kafog: praox-druwyn

## Deployment

ReceiptWren, our donation-receipt mailer, deploys from the `stable` branch via the Quillgate pipeline. Before promoting a build, confirm the template bundle version matches what the Harbrook finance team signed off on, since receipts are legally sensitive. Run the dry-run mailer against the sandbox donor list and inspect at least three rendered PDFs. Rollbacks must restore both the binary and the template bundle together; mismatched pairs produce blank totals. The environment expects the following configuration values at startup.

settings of tawif-tafog:
[oliox]
port = 7000
team = pelius
host = oliox.plorvaforge.corp
region = upper-2
access_code = ac_48b9f0
timeout_ms = 3000

Q3 Planning Note — Treasury

Following volatility in the vendel against the crown, Marvale Instruments will hedge 60% of projected Q3 receivables from the Ostrevia region, up from 40%. Finance lead Tove Brandt modelled both positions; the cost difference is immaterial against downside exposure. Board sign-off expected next week. Context for the decision follows below.

management briefing: Project Ulavan slips by two quarters because of the staffing delay.